Ordinals
beta
Sat 1412451036769661
decimal
354980.1036769661
degree
0°144980′164″1036769661‴
percentile
67.25957325349323%
name
dvpkfechplk
cycle
0
epoch
1
period
176
block
354980
offset
1036769661
timestamp
2015-05-05 00:09:16 UTC
rarity
common
prev
next